Raoul Trujillo Biography

Raoul Trujillo (born Raoul Maximiano Trujillo de Chauvelon) is an actor, choreographer, and theatrical director from the United States. He is the founder, choreographer, and co-director of the American Indian Dance Theatre. He was previous soloist with the Nikolais Dance Theatre. Trujillo has worked in film, television, and theater for more than 30 years, as well as hosting number of dance shows. He has been nominated for Critics’ Choice Award.

Trujillo is most known for his roles in Mel Gibson’s Apocalypto (2006) as Zero Wolf, merciless Mayan slave hunter, and in the film Black Robe as the Iroquois leader Kiotseaton. He has starred in number of well-known and critically praised films, including The New World, Cowboys and Aliens, Riddick, Blood Father, Sicario, and Sicario: Day of the Soldado. 
He also appeared in scores of television shows, including True Blood, Lost Girl, Da Vinci’s Demons, Salem, The Blacklist, and Jamestown, in both supporting and starring parts. He currently plays Che “Taza” Romero with Mayans M.C.

Raoul Trujillo Career

He began his career in the theater as scenic painter before landing his first role as an actor/dancer in performance of Equus in 1977. In 1978, he began dancing at the University of Southern California, where he saw his first modern dance and ballet shoes, including Pilobolus, Martha Graham, and Rudolf Nureyev. 
On scholarship, he spent the next two years training with the Toronto Dance Theatre and Nikolais/Louis Dance Lab in New York City. He was invited to join the Nikolais Dance Theatre, which he joined under the guidance of master Alwin Nikolais, who became his mentor and with whom he toured the world. Between 1980 and 1987, he also studied scenic, costume, and lighting design.
Following his departure from the group, he began working as solo dancer and choreographer, embarking on journey into shamanic rituals and incorporating native myths and stories into his work. 
He became the choreographer and co-director of the American Indian Dance Theatre, the first professional native dance group that combined traditional dance with contemporary interpretation of myths and tales, after decade of performing as dancer. 
“The Shaman’s Journey,” which he choreographed for the Asia Society in New York, was eventually transformed into short film for PBS’s Alive from Off Center. He then moved to Toronto to work with artistic colleagues Alejandro Roncerria and René Highway.
Native Earth Performing Arts was able to produce successful theatre productions as result of this work. His collaboration with Alejandro continued, and he assisted in the establishment of the Aboriginal Dance Project at the Banff Centre, which aims to train Indigenous dancers from around the world. 
In 2002, he was awarded CANCOM Ross Charles scholarship to the Banff Center’s screenwriters program for aboriginal storytellers. 
Trujillo began his cinematic acting career in Canada in 1988 and has over 107 film and television credits to his name. He also acted as Tomocomo in Terrence Malick’s The New World, choreographing the dances, ceremonies, and rituals.
